纸杯蛋糕、甜甜圈、手指饼、冻酸奶、姜饼、蜜蜂巢、冰淇淋三明治、果冻豆、KitKat 巧克力、棒棒糖。
每一个重大的 Android 版本更新,Google 都会给它们取一个甜腻腻的名字,同时山景城总部的草坪上也会新增添一座雕塑。在今天早晨,Android 开发副总裁 Dave Burke 在 Twitter 上公布了 Android M 的名字。
M is for Marshmallow,也就是棉花糖。
1.0 和 1.1 版本的 Android 代号都是以机器人命名,从 1.5 版本开始,Android 每个版本变成以甜品来命名并延续至今,而每个名字遵循着首字母的先后顺序来确定,至今已经排到 M。通过上面的视频我们简单回顾了一下 Android 系统与各类甜品有什么关系。
2009 年 4 月 30 日,Google 发布 Android 1.5,开始了用甜点作为系统版本代号的做法,该版本代号是 C 开头的 Cupcake,加入了虚拟键盘,支持桌面小插件以及中文显示。
不到半年后,2009 年 9 月 15 日,Android 1.6 发布,代号为 Donut,加入了重新设计的 Android 市场,支持手势操控和 CDMA 网络。
一个多月后,Android 2.0 登场,代号 Eclair,这个版本加入了对数位变焦的支持,在之后的 2.0.1 以及 2.1 版本以 Eclair 为代号。
2010 年 5 月 20 日,Android 2.2 发布,支持将软件安装至内存,这次它的代号来到了字母 F,取名为 Froyo。后续的 Android 2.2.1 版本也沿用了这个代号。
半年多以后,Android 2.3 发布,取名 Gingerbread,当时 Android 手机的屏幕开始有越来越大的趋势,该版本也顺势加入了对更高分辨率的支持。同时也支持 NFC 技术和 Google Talk 视频通话。
之后 Google 在 2011 年 2 月 2 日发布了 Android 3.0,这是一个专为平板电脑设计的版本,代号 Honeycomb。
而用于手机的下一个重大版本更新一直要等到 2011 年 10 月发布的 Android 4.0,代号 Ice Cream Sandwich,一同发布的还有三太子 Galaxy Nexus 手机。
2012年6月28日,谷歌发布 Android 4.1,代号 Jelly Bean,启动了黄油计划,大幅提升了运行速度和流畅性,此外这个版本还加入 Google Now 的支持,成为苹果 Siri 最强大的敌人。
2013 年底,Android 4.4 发布,代号 KitKat,加入了全新的 Java 虚拟机运行环境 ART。随后的四个版本更新都沿用了这个代号。
2014 年,Android L 发布,代号 Lollipop,采用了全新 Material Design 界面,统一了 Android 手机的视觉风格。加入了对 64 位处理器和蓝牙 4.1 的支持。
最新的 Android M 在今年 6 月的 Google I/O 上发布,该版本支持系统级别的指纹识别功能并加入了Android Pay 移动支付功能,并在今天将代号确认为 Marshmallow。
按照这个传统,下一个版本的 Android 将会以 N 开头的甜品来命名,大家可以开始猜猜看,到时 Google 会用什么甜点让你 Sweet 一下呢?